Arub is a girl's name. In 2009 it was given to 3 babies in England and Wales.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.
- Peaked in England and Wales in 1999, when 7 babies were given the name.
- It has largely dropped out of use in England and Wales.
- First appears in birth records in 1996.

How popular is Arub?
In 2009, Arub was given to 3 babies in England and Wales.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.
Figures for England and Wales withhold any name given to fewer than three babies in a year, so a gap means the name fell below that floor rather than went unused. Data & sources.
